A plant accident would delay the trade ten or 15 years. A synchronized global recession or depression that reduce society's ability to build nuclear power plants and reduce their need for them too. Rapidly rising interest rates would make new plant construction more expensive. They would raise the cost of equity too, because the capitalized value of distribution streams would go down.
